Retirement Savings

1. Start Early: The key to building a substantial retirement fund is to start saving as early as possible. By doing so, you allow your money to grow through compound interest over a longer period. Even small contributions made consistently can have a significant impact in the long run.

2. Set Clear Goals: Determine how much you would like to have saved by the time you retire. This will help you create a realistic savings plan and ensure that you are on track to meet your financial objectives.

3. Explore Retirement Accounts: Take advantage of retirement savings accounts such as 401(k)s or IRAs. These accounts offer tax advantages and can help accelerate your savings. Consult with a financial advisor to determine which options are best suited for your needs.

4. Diversify Investments: Don’t put all your eggs in one basket. Diversify your investments to spread the risk and potentially increase your returns. Consider investing in stocks, bonds, real estate, and other options that align with your risk tolerance and financial goals.

Insurance Benefits

Health Insurance

1. Understand Coverage: Review your health insurance policy to understand what services and treatments are covered. This will help you make informed decisions about your healthcare and avoid unexpected expenses.

2. Utilize Preventive Care: Take advantage of preventive care services covered by your insurance. Regular check-ups, vaccinations, and screenings can help detect potential issues early on, saving you from costly treatments in the future.

3. Compare Plans: Compare different health insurance plans to ensure you are getting the best coverage at the most affordable price. Consider factors such as premiums, deductibles, and network providers to find the plan that suits your needs.

Life Insurance

1. Assess Coverage Needs: Evaluate your financial obligations and determine how much life insurance coverage you require. This will ensure that your loved ones are financially protected in the event of your untimely demise.

2. Term vs. Permanent: Understand the difference between term and permanent life insurance. Term life insurance provides coverage for a specific period, while permanent life insurance offers lifelong protection. Choose the option that aligns with your financial goals and budget.

3. Review Beneficiaries: Regularly review and update your life insurance beneficiaries. Life changes such as marriage, divorce, or the birth of a child may require adjustments to ensure your benefits are distributed according to your wishes.

Disability Insurance

1. Assess Income Protection: Calculate how much of your income you would need to replace in the event of a disability. Disability insurance helps safeguard your financial stability by providing a portion of your income if you are unable to work due to a disability.

2. Understand Policy Terms: Familiarize yourself with the terms and conditions of your disability insurance policy. Be aware of waiting periods, benefit periods, and any exclusions to ensure you fully understand what is covered.

3. Consider Supplemental Coverage: Depending on your occupation, you may need additional coverage beyond what your employer provides. Supplemental disability insurance can bridge the gap and provide enhanced protection.
